I hope you have all had a good break, have not stressed too much about assessment tasks, and have started to get to grips with our new distant learning reality.  I must admit, I am keen to get back to Mission Heights and to catch up with you all in person, but until that is an option for us, we will have to do the best we can.  This week (and possibly next week) I would like to focus our reading and writing on looking at some distant learning that has been happening for many years- some of you may have some knowledge already, of how school students in the outback of Australia access education - for others this will be a brand new concept. We will read articles and stories about The School of the Air and write to share our information.

    Success Criteria: I can/have...

        • locate information in a text
        • skim and scan for supporting detail
        • make notes
        • use notes to create an informational report
        • use subheadings 
        • use images and captions

    Activities:

    1. Read the attached website and make notes about The School of the Air
    2. Locate additional readings about The School of the Air
    3. Write an information report including subheadings, images and captions to support and convey your ideas
